Adamah’s Jewish Green Business Network gathered in Los Angeles for their first Climate Week LA event, bringing together climate professionals, philanthropists, founders, investors, and community leaders to explore a timely question: What does Jewish climate resilience look like in this moment?
In the wake of last year’s devastating Southern California fires, their conversation focused not only on resilience in the face of climate impacts, but also on sustaining hope, community, and action during challenging times.
